Ingredients You’ll Need

This recipe keeps things wonderfully simple, relying on a few key ingredients that each play a vital role in making your Cheddar Cubes Pretzel Sparklers Recipe pop. From the sharpness of the cheese to the natural sweetness and juiciness of the grapes or cherry tomatoes, every element contributes to a perfect balance of texture, flavor, and color.

  • 7 oz sharp cheddar cheese: Cut into 3/4-inch cubes for the star of the dish, providing a rich, tangy flavor and creamy texture.
  • 2 tbsp chopped chives or fresh parsley (optional): Adds a fresh herbal aroma and a gentle punch of green color to brighten the presentation.
  • 1 tbsp poppy seeds or toasted sesame seeds (optional): Sprinkled on top for a subtle nuttiness and charming visual appeal.
  • 24 thin pretzel sticks: These give the sparklers a satisfying crunch and structural base, easy to hold and snack on.
  • 24 seedless red or green grapes: Use for a juicy burst of sweetness as a colorful complement to the savory cheese.
  • 24 cherry tomato halves: For a refreshing, slightly tangy twist that elevates the flavor profile beautifully.

How to Make Cheddar Cubes Pretzel Sparklers Recipe

Step 1: Prepare Cheese Cubes

Begin by cutting your sharp cheddar cheese into neat 3/4-inch cubes. Consistent size helps the sparklers look uniform and ensures each bite has that perfect balance of flavor and texture. Lay these cubes evenly on a plate or tray to keep them ready for the next step.

Step 2: Add Garnishes

To make your Cheddar Cubes Pretzel Sparklers Recipe stand out, gently roll or sprinkle the cheese cubes with chopped chives, parsley, poppy seeds, or toasted sesame seeds. These simple additions enhance not only the flavor but also add a lovely touch of color and texture that invites guests to dig in.

Step 3: Assemble Sparklers

Skewer each cheddar cube onto one end of a pretzel stick. This is where the magic happens and your snack begins to look like festive sparklers ready to light up any party table. The sturdy pretzel stick acts as the perfect handle for easy snacking.

Step 4: Incorporate Optional Additions

For an extra pop of color and flavor, thread a seedless grape or a cherry tomato half onto the pretzel stick before the cheese cube. This layering creates beautiful contrasts and adds juicy bursts that make every bite exciting.

Step 5: Presentation

Stand your assembled sparklers upright on a serving platter to showcase their vibrant colors and playful shapes. Serving immediately ensures the cheese remains fresh and the pretzel sticks stay wonderfully crunchy, making these the ultimate grab-and-go appetizer.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

If you happen to have leftovers, store the unscrewed cheese cubes and fresh additions separately in airtight containers in the refrigerator to keep them fresh. Pretzels can be kept at room temperature in a sealed bag to maintain their crunch.

Freezing

While not ideal, you can freeze the cheese cubes independently if needed. However, freezing pretzel sticks or grapes and tomatoes is not recommended as it changes their texture drastically. Plan to assemble the sparklers fresh for the best taste and texture.

Reheating

Since this recipe is best served cold or at room temperature, reheating is not necessary. Just bring the cheddar out of the fridge a little before serving to soften slightly and release its full flavor.

FAQs

Can I use other types of cheese?

Absolutely! While sharp cheddar is classic for this recipe, you can experiment with Monterey Jack, Gouda, or even pepper jack for a spicy twist. Just make sure the cheese is firm enough to hold its shape on the pretzel stick.

Are there alternatives to pretzel sticks?

If pretzel sticks are hard to find, you might try breadsticks or even sturdy vegetable sticks like celery or carrot for a healthier variation, though the classic crunch of the pretzel adds a unique flavor and texture you won’t want to miss.

How far in advance can I prepare these sparklers?

It’s best to assemble these sparklers shortly before serving to keep the pretzels crisp and the fresh elements vibrant. You can prepare ingredients in advance, but put together the skewers just before your gathering.

Can I make this recipe kid-friendly?

Definitely! Kids love the fun shape and sweet-savory flavor combination. Simply skip any seeds or herbs that might be too intense and use mild cheddar and red grapes for familiar tastes.

What drinks pair well with Cheddar Cubes Pretzel Sparklers Recipe?

These sparklers pair beautifully with crisp white wines like Sauvignon Blanc, light beers, or even sparkling water with a splash of citrus, making them a versatile snack for many occasions.

Ingredients

Scale

Cheese and Garnishes

  • 7 oz sharp cheddar cheese, cut into 3/4-inch cubes
  • 2 tbsp chopped chives or fresh parsley (optional)
  • 1 tbsp poppy seeds or toasted sesame seeds (optional)

Assembly

  • 24 thin pretzel sticks
  • 24 seedless red or green grapes
  • 24 cherry tomato halves


Instructions

  1. Prepare cheese cubes: Cut the sharp cheddar cheese into uniform 3/4-inch cubes for easy skewering and consistent bites.
  2. Arrange the cheese: Spread the cheese cubes evenly on a plate or tray to keep them organized for garnish application.
  3. Add garnishes: Lightly roll or sprinkle selected cheese cubes with chopped chives, fresh parsley, poppy seeds, or toasted sesame seeds to enhance their flavor and appearance.
  4. Assemble sparklers: Skewer each cheddar cube onto one end of a pretzel stick carefully to create the sparkler shape.
  5. Incorporate optional additions: For added color and taste, slide a seedless grape or a cherry tomato half onto the pretzel stick before the cheese cube.
  6. Presentation: Stand the assembled sparklers upright on a serving platter and serve immediately to enjoy the best texture and freshness.

Notes

  • Use fresh herbs like chives or parsley to add a burst of flavor and vibrant color.
  • Optional seeds like poppy or toasted sesame seeds provide extra texture and nuttiness.
  • Serving sparklers immediately ensures the pretzels remain crunchy and the cheese stays firm.
  • These treats are best served fresh and should be refrigerated if not consumed right away to maintain cheese quality.
  • Substitute with gluten-free pretzel sticks to make this appetizer gluten-free.
